Extendable Belt Conveyors: Optimizing Space Utilization

In fast-paced industrial settings, space is a limited resource. Extendable belt conveyors offer a efficient solution to maximize available floor space. These systems feature belts that can be simply extended or retracted depending on the task at hand, providing a customized conveying solution that adapts to changing demands. By minimizing the need for fixed-length conveyors, extendable belt systems clear valuable floor space for other operations or machinery, improving overall operational efficiency.

Telescopic Belt Conveyor Design Considerations for Challenging Environments

Designing telescopic belt conveyors for extreme environments presents a unique set of challenges. Factors such as temperature fluctuations, harsh materials, and potential vibrations must be carefully considered during the design phase. A robust conveyor system should utilize durable components, such as alloy structures, and incorporate sealed motors to withstand the demands of these environments.

Proper lubrication strategies are essential for maintaining smooth operation and minimizing wear. Conveyor belts must be specified based on their impact resistance, while traction is a key concern when conveying powdered materials.

Moreover, security should be a top concern in challenging environments. Implementing guardrails and incorporating emergency systems are vital for safeguarding personnel.
